Arkansas Black Apple tree

Owner: John

Location:  Ben Lomond, CA, United States

Age:Planted in about
Rootstock:M-111
Soil:Sandy 
Climate at this location:Mediterranian
Pruning:Pruned annually
Tree form:Central leader (widest at bottom)
Height:Between 6ft / 2m and 15ft / 4m
Cropping:Light crops
Growth:This tree grows easily here
Herbicides:Manual treatment (hoeing and weeding)
Pesticides:Un-treated
Local pests:Gophers

Owner's comments

Gophers attacked this full grown tree two years ago. There was one main root left. We dug the tree up and re-wrapped in 1/2" galvanized hardware cloth and cut the tree back to near the trunk to balance with the minimal roots. Two years now and the tree is doing as expected after such trauma. Branches have been getting larger and we are not allowing the apples to set so as to provide all energy to recovery. Another two years should have this tree back to producing delicious dark read crunchy apples!
